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ention
Numerous HVAC problems call for emergency service. Acknowledging these problems can assist you know when to call for expert aid:
- Complete System Failure
When your heating or cooling system stops working completely, especially throughout extreme weather condition, it's more than simply an trouble-- it can be dangerous. Our emergency HVAC contractors can detect and fix the problem immediately,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
- Uncommon Noises or Smells
Odd seem like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system typically signify a serious mechanical issue that could result in larger concerns if not attended to rapidly. Likewise, unusual smells may suggest electrical problems or even gas leakages. Our expert HVAC professionals can identify these issues and make necessary repairs before they end up being hazardous.
- Water Leaks
Water dripping from your HVAC system can damage your home and result in mold growth. Our specialists find the source of leakages and repair them appropriately to prevent water damage.
- Refrigerant Leaks
Refrigerant leakages reduce your a/c unit's cooling capacity and can harm the environment. They need professional attention as refrigerant managing calls for specialized training and equipment.
- Electrical Issues
Problems with electrical parts in your HVAC system pose fire dangers and need to be addressed instantly by qualified specialists. Our HVAC specialists have the training to securely fix electrical issues.

Cooling Maintenance
Regular maintenance keeps your cooling system running efficiently. Our professional HVAC specialists carry out thorough maintenance services that include:
- Cleaning or replacing air filters
- Examining refrigerant levels
- Cleaning condenser and evaporator coils
- Checking and cleaning drain lines
- Checking electrical connections
- Lubing moving parts
- Testing thermostat operation
- Validating correct airflow

Heating System Maintenance
Regular maintenance prevents many heating issues and extends the life of your system. Our professional HVAC professionals carry out extensive upkeep services that include:
-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
- Inspecting combustion effectiveness
- Checking safety controls
- Cleaning up or replacing filters
- Inspecting electrical connections
- Oiling moving parts
- Cleaning up burners and changing the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face
- Poor Airflow
Limited air flow makes your system work more difficult and minimizes comfort. Our HVAC contractors recognize air flow issues, whether caused by duct problems, filthy filters, or fan issues.
- Unequal Heating or Cooling
If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ct problems, insulation issues, or an incorrectly sized system. Our expert HVAC professionals can identify these problems and recommend solutions.
- Brief Cycling
When your system switches on and off frequently, it loses energy and wears elements faster. Our HVAC professionals can figure out whether the problem stems from a clogged up fil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more severe.
- High Energy Bills
Abrupt increases in energy bills often suggest HVAC ineffectiveness. Our professionals carry out energy efficiency evaluations to determine the cause and suggest improvements.
- Humidity Problems
Modern HVAC systems need to assist control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C professionals can advise options to enhance comfort and air quality.
- Thermostat Problems
In some cases what appears like a system failure is in fact a thermostat issue. Our HVAC specialists can fix or change th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or wise designs for much better comfort control and energy cost savings.
